Areas of responsibility
As Grid Connection Development Engineer, your primary task is to design the electrical part of the wind farms and ensure grid compliance. Moreover, you participate in relevant project meetings and cooperate with other team members on shared issues. You also ensure that management is informed about risks and problems and communicate with transmission system operators and distribution network operators.
Additionally, you handle other aspects in connection with the projects, eg cost estimates, and support environmental impact assessments and prepare grid connection solutions. You also prepare project gate documents.
Furthermore, your key duties will be to:
- design the overall electrical system from onshore to the wind turbine generator
- perform grid compliance studies on the wind farms, such as power flow, voltage control, dynamic analysis, fault ride through and harmonic studies
- involve internal and external specialists.
